4. (20) When a person inhales, air moves down the bronchus ( wind pipe) at 15 cm/s. The average flow speed of the air doubles through a constriction in the bronchus. Assuming incompressible flow, and the change in height is small ( h = 0 ) determine the pressure drop in the constriction.



A solar heater consists of a curved reflecting mirror that focuses sunlight on an object. The solar power per unit area reaching the Earth at the location of 0 .5 m-diameter solar heater is 600 W/m2. Assuming that only 50% of the incident energy is converted to heat energy, how long will it take this heater to evaporate 1.0 L of Water, initially at 20o C? (Neglect the specific heat of the container holding the Water.) (1 L = 1000g, c = 1 cal/goC, Latent Heat of Vaporization for water L=540 cal / g, 1 cal = 4.186 J )
